Events in the Twin Cities June 2015

The kids are out of school and summer is finally in full swing. June in the Twin Cities is a wonderful place to be. From outdoor Saints games at the new CHS feel in lower town to the fresh and family fun farmer’s markets that pop up around town there is always something going on.

June is a great month to see some beautiful homes too. This year is the second annual Artisan Home Tour and Custom One Homes is proud to participate in it again, with two homes this year.

Artisan Home Tour

When: June 5-7, 12-14, 19-21 | 1-7pm
Where: Various homes throughout the Twin Cities

This is the second year of the Artisan Home Tour and it’s even better than last year. The 2015 Artisan Home Tour features 22 of the region’s most exquisite homes. You’ll get to tour new homes designed and constructed by exceptional homebuilders, and new this year are four amazing remodeled homes by the regions top remodelers (open the final weekend only). Whether new or remodeled, these are all incredible residences which truly combine artistic vision with master craftsmanship, and do it perfectly. Each has been reviewed by our Architectural Review Panel to assure they meet the exacting standards of design, high-level finish, and impeccable craftsmanship, which make them Artisan Homes. Custom One Homes has two executive level homes on the tour this year.

Custom One Homes in Woodbury

#13 | 7640 Glen Alcove, Woodbury, MN 55129
Enjoy a warm welcome at this craftsman-style abode, unmatched in beauty by its oversized wrap-around front porch, peaked gables and scenic views. Not just a beautiful facade, a true Artisan interior with one-of-a-kind finishes awaits as you make your way inside.
Outstanding features of this home include:

[list type=”star”]

  • 6 bedrooms, 5 baths, 3- car garage and 4,700 finished square feet
  • Grand exterior with classic board and batten siding, gables, cedar brackets and wrap around porch
  • Soaring vaulted great room with extensive interior detailing, including oversized enameled woodwork
  • Custom-designed fireplace boasts an entire wall of detailing for entertaining
  • Wide plank rift and quarter-sawn white oak site-finished wood floors
  • Inviting spa-like master suite includes free-standing bathtub and oversized shower
  • Gourmet-level kitchen features expansive walk-in pantry, custom cabinetry with distressed island and top quality Thermador appliances
  • Finished lower level perfect for entertaining with a pub style wet bar, natural stone fireplace and exercise room
  • Wirsbo in-floor heating in master bath, garage and lower level add comfort to your living experience
  • For sale at $1,099,550

[/list]

Directions: I-94 to Radio Drive, South to Glen Road, West to Glen Alcove, North to Model on right.

Saint Anthony Park Arts Festival
Where: Como Avenue and Carter Avenue, St. Paul, MN
When: June 6th, 2015 | 10am – 5pm

Now in its 46th year, the Saint Anthony Park Arts Festival brings together artists, musicians, art lovers, families and a supportive community. The festival benefits the historic St. Anthony Park Branch of the St. Paul Public Library. It engages children and adults alike with fun activities for the whole family. Bike MS: C.H. Robinson MS 150 Ride
Where: Duluth to the Twin Cities
When: June 12 – 14

Bike MS: C.H. Robinson MS 150 Ride 2015 is a two-day, fully supported cycling adventure that starts in Duluth and finishes in the Twin Cities. You’ll enjoy a free bus ride to Duluth Friday, where your bike and friends await. Saturday, you’ll join nearly 4,000 cyclists and travel the scenic Willard Munger Trail to Hinckley where you’ll celebrate your halfway victory at a festive overnight. Sunday, when you cross the finish line, you’ll have helped change the world for people with multiple sclerosis.

Rock The Garden 2015
Where: Walker Art Center/Minneapolis Sculpture Garden
When: June 20 – 21, 2015 | 2pm – 10pm

The two best days of summer are back! The most picturesque festival in the Twin Cities, Rock the Garden returns for two days of great music in the heart of the city.
